用遗传算法求解组合拍卖竞胜标
Genetic Algorithm for Solving Winner Determination in Combinatorial Auctions
【摘要】 从电子商务中的组合拍卖机理出发,以第一价格密封拍卖方式为背景,通过分析组合拍卖标的集和竞胜标确定的复杂性,给出了组合拍卖竞胜标确定问题的一般模型,并指出了该问题为离散组合优化问题·然后通过引入智能算法的思想,在遗传算法中采用单亲遗传算子和嵌入优先适合启发式规则,设计了求解该模型的优先适合启发式单亲遗传算法·计算实例表明,利用该算法求解竞胜标确定问题的最优解,算法实现简单,计算效果良好,且不需要复杂的交叉和变异等操作·
【Abstract】 Beginning with combinatorial auctions mechanisms in the electronic commerce,the complexity of the set of target and winner determination was analyzed on the background of the firstprice sealed auction. The general model of winner determination in combinatorial auctions was formulated. The model indicated that it was a problem on combinatorial optimization. By adopting parthenogenetic operators and embedding the FittingFirst heuristic rules,a parthenogenetic algorithm was presented on the basis of the ideas of heuristic algorithms. The algorithm is simple to apply and can achieve fine outcome to solve this problem without requiring complex operators of crossover and mutation.
